高灵敏显色体系的研究——Ga-邻氯苯基萤光酮-CTMAB 体系
A HIGHLY SENSITIVE COLOUR REACTION IN THE SYSTEM GALLIUM-o-CHLORO-PHENYLFLUORONE-CTMAB
【摘要】 本文提出了一种简单、灵敏和选择性好的痕量镓的分光光度法,研究了配合物形成过程中CTMAB的增敏作用。在CTMAB存在下,镓配合物在波长为585nm处呈最大吸收,且其摩尔吸光系数为1.57×105L·mol-1·cm-1,镓配合物的形成酸度从pH8.6到9.8,配合物中镓与邻氯苯基萤光酮的摩尔比为1:3。镓量在0.04-0.64PPm范围内遵从比尔定律,此法适用于矿石样品痕量镓的测定。
【Abstract】 A simple sensitive and selective method for the spectrophotometric determination of trace Ga has been developed. The sensitization action of CTMAB on the colour reaction and conditions of the complex formation are offered. In the presence of CTMAB the gallium complex exhibits maximum absorption at 505 nm with a molar absorptivity of 1. 57×105 L·mol-1·cm-1. The complex of Ga is formed from pH 8. 6 to 9. 8. The molar ratio of Ga to o-chlorophenyl-fluorone is 1: 3. Beer′s law is obeyed in the range of 0. 04—0. 64 ppm of Ga. This method is applicable to the determination of Ga in rocks.
